The Real Wrap Company recalls ready-to-eat products due to Listeria contamination

The Real Wrap Company Ltd is taking the precautionary action of recalling ready-to-eat products including sandwiches, paninis, rolls, toasties, and wraps because of the possible presence of Listeria monocytogenes. This recall only affects products sold at retail stores in healthcare settings.Symptoms caused by this organism can be similar to flu and include high temperature, muscle ache or pain, chills, feeling or being sick and diarrhoea. However, in rare cases, the infection can be more severe, causing serious complications, such as meningitis. Some people are more vulnerable to listeria infections, including older people, pregnant women and their unborn babies, babies less than one month old and people with weakened immune systems.
You can see the list of affected products in the pictures attached or in the link below.
If you have bought any of those products from healthcare settings, do not eat them. Instead, return it to where it was bought for a refund.
